ResumoAbstract The density and zonation of intertidal polychaetes and molluscs were studied on a muddy shore at Öydegard some 15 km SE of Kristiansund. Eight localities between MLWS and MHWN were investigated, one with a 0.1 m2 frame and the rest with a 0.25 m2 frame. Of the 18 species found, three were dominant and the results showed a typical Macoma balthica community (“a boreal shallow mud association”).
